VIZ MEDIA'S PRESCHOOL SENSATION
DEKO BOKO FRIENDS TO ENTERTAIN CHILDREN ON TREEHOUSE TV
Groundbreaking Hit Show by Japanese Animation Leader to Air on
Treehouse Canada's Preschool Destination
San Francisco, CA, August 25, 2005 VIZ Media, LLC. (VIZ Media), one of
the entertainment industry's most innovative and comprehensive manga and
animation licensing and publishing companies, will introduce the hit TV
show DEKO BOKO FRIENDS on Treehouse TV, Canada's top rated preschool
destination beginning in September.
Treehouse will air 61 episodes of the uniquely original DEKO BOKO
FRIENDS, VIZ Media's debut Japanese animation property for preschool
audiences that delivers positive messages to children in a charming and
witty manner. Since its debut in Japan in April 2002 on NHK, Japan's
public television channel, DEKO BOKO FRIENDS has won the hearts and
minds of children teaching lasting life lessons of acceptance and
difference. With its airing on Treehouse, DEKO BOKO FRIENDS continues
to build on that momentum with successful launches in the U.S. and now
in Canada.

DEKO BOKO FRIENDS, the first Japanese preschool animated show to ever
ink a deal with Nickelodeon, is produced as 30-second animated shorts,
and features 12 unique characters that help teach children about
diversity and tolerance. The show currently airs on Nick Jr., Noggin
Nickelodeon's commercial-free educational network for preschoolers and
Nicktoons, Nickelodeon's 24-hour cartoon channel.
The world of DEKO BOKO FRIENDS will be available to children in toys
from Spin Master and in books from Simon & Schuster. Additional
licensees will be announced shortly.

About VIZ Media, LLC
Headquartered in San Francisco, CA, VIZ Media, LLC (VIZ Media), is one of
the most comprehensive and innovative companies in the field of manga
publishing, animation and entertainment licensing of Japanese content. Owned
by three of Japan's largest creators and licensors of manga and animation,
Shueisha Inc., Shogakukan Inc., and Shogakukan Production Co., Ltd. (ShoPro
Japan), VIZ Media is a leader in the publishing and distribution of Japanese
manga for English speaking audiences in North America and a global licensor
of Japanese animation and manga. The company offers an integrated product
line including, magazines such as SHONEN JUMP and Shojo Beat, graphic
novels, videos, DVDs, audio soundtracks and develops and markets animated
entertainment from initial production, television placement and
distribution, to merchandise licensing and promotions for audiences and
consumers of all ages.
